I stayed at an art hotel in Okayama, the city of art.The two-bed room has a living room.There is no TV. The bath and sink are located up a steep flight of stairs.The toilet is on the first floor, and music plays when you enter.The bridge that crosses over to Korakuen is right next door, so it's nice to take a walk.The Prefectural Museum of Art is right next door, and there is also a delicious bakery nearby.Craft beer shops are also nearby.I had a relaxing time💖
